Answer: Tree topology is suitable for multiple networks due to its scalability, hierarchical structure, redundancy, reliability, and flexibility in design, this allows the proper management and secure segmentation of network resources.The tree topology is suitable for multiple networks due to below reasons. Provides ScalabilityThe Tree topology allows us to easily apply the scalability by adding or removing branches, which makes it adaptable to the changing needs of multiple networks. Hierarchical StructureThe tree topology has the hierarchical structure which mainly organizes networks into levels, their enables proper management and control of network traffic and resources. Redundancy and ReliabilityThe Tree topology inherently provides redundancy through multiple paths, this makes sure that if one branch fails, the other routes can actually maintain network connectivity and reliability. SegmentationBy segmenting networks into branches and subbranches, tree topology enables the logical isolation and also improves security by limiting access to specific network segments. Flexibility in DesignTree topology allows for different network types to coexist within its structure, such as wired and wireless networks, enabling diverse connectivity options. |
